Background
- Background: Sterol regulatory element-binding protein cleavage-activating protein (SCAP) is a protein with a sterol sensing domain (SSD) and seven WD domains. In the presence of cholesterol, SCAP binds to sterol regulatory element binding proteins (SREBPs) and mediates their transport from the ER to the Golgi. The SREBPs are then proteolytically cleaved and regulate sterol biosynthesis [taken from NCBI Entrez Gene (Gene ID: 22937)].
